Package util

Class Settings


  • public class Settings
    extends java.lang.Object
    Created by hp on 7/7/2016.
    • Constructor Summary

      Constructors 
      Constructor Description
      Settings()  
      Settings​(java.lang.String password, boolean activated, java.lang.String userName, long activationDate)  
    • Method Summary

      Modifier and Type Method Description
      long getActivationDate()  
      java.lang.String getPassword()  
      java.lang.String getUserName()  
      boolean isActivated()  
      static Settings parseJson​(java.lang.String settingsJson)  
      void setActivated​(boolean activated)  
      void setActivationDate​(long activationDate)  
      void setPassword​(java.lang.String password)  
      void setUserName​(java.lang.String userName)  
      java.lang.String toString()  
      • Methods inherited from class java.lang.Object

        cl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
    • Constructor Detail

      • Settings

        public Settings()
      • Settings

        public Settings​(java.lang.String password,
                        boolean activated,
                        java.lang.String userName,
                        long activationDate)
    • Method Detail

      • getUserName

        public java.lang.String getUserName()
      • setUserName

        public void setUserName​(java.lang.String userName)
      • getPassword

        public java.lang.String getPassword()
      • setPassword

        public void setPassword​(java.lang.String password)
      • isActivated

        public boolean isActivated()
      • setActivated

        public void setActivated​(boolean activated)
      • getActivationDate

        public long getActivationDate()
      • setActivationDate

        public void setActivationDate​(long activationDate)
      • parseJson

        public static Settings parseJson​(java.lang.String settingsJson)
        Parameters:
        settingsJson - A json describing a valid Settings data
        Returns:
        an Settings object that encapsulates the json.
      • toString

        public java.lang.String toString()
        Overrides:
        toString in class java.lang.Object